    If the new pump doesn't have a check valve or if the FPR or injectors are leaking the fuel rail will lose pressure when the engine is off. With a good OE pump the rail should see normal pressure in just a few turns of the engine, even if the rail pressure starts at zero. But if the injectors are leaking, you'd still be faced with flooded engine and a good number of turns of th engine would be required to clear the engine.


    The pump you fitted may have higher pressure, but a lower flow rate and might be missing the check valve. Replace that trash with a new OE pump. And make sure that the FPR and injectors aren't leaking.
